Before selecting a specific model to book, check your planned routes. If you are going to drive mostly within the The Hague borders, choose a car of 'Standard' or 'Compact' types. In case you plan long cross-countries trips or mountain adventures, the more comfortable and powerful 'Fullsize' models would become a better choice.

If you need a car with an automatic gearbox, try to make a reservation at least a few days before the pick-up date, since confirmation of such models in The Hague might be delayed for a day or two.

Upon the return of your car, carefully check that the total payment amount (invoice) is computed according to the original rental conditions.

Local drivers are well aware of the traffic regulations, and they treat other drivers with respect. In this country, it is absolutely normal to pay particular attention to pedestrians and drivers of bicycles and motorbikes, who have an undeniable advantage on the road.
Despite strict regulations and heavy fines, accidents are quite rare on the roads of the Netherlands. A large number of accidents happen with bicycle riders involved. According to the statistics, in the majority of such accidents the driver of the vehicle is considered guilty. There is a special attitude to cyclists in the country.
The majority of traffic rules in the country have almost nothing different comparing to traffic regulations of other European countries. Overtaking is permitted on the left side only, and in roundabouts cars that move in the circle have the advantage.

Among the cultural attractions of the city we should definitely mention Gevangenpoort Museum, which is located in a beautiful castle of the 16th century. Gevangenpoort is a pretty grim, but a no less attractive institution. It offers to its guests the exhibition of most unusual torture instruments. You can also visit the cell where once has been imprisoned Cornelius Witt.

The famous three-naved church is not only an important religious landmark, but also a valuable architectural monument. Elegant stained glass windows and arches, beautiful coats of arms decorating the hall of the church - every piece of furniture here is a valuable museum exhibit. Peace Palace belongs to more recent architectural monuments. Nowadays the palace often becomes the place of conduction of significant business activities. One of the symbols of the city is a beautiful arch erected in the 19th century – the Passage. Next to this amazing sight you will find cozy restaurants and souvenir shops.
